The Hafilat card is a smart card used for buses and some public transport services across Abu Dhabi. It works like many other contactless travel cards worldwide: you load money onto the card, and the fare is automatically deducted whenever you use it. Where You Can Recharge Hafilat Card

One of the best aspects of the Hafilat system is its flexibility. There are multiple ways to recharge Hafilat card, making it easy to maintain balance regardless of your schedule. The simplest method is using the official Hafilat app. By downloading the app, you can link your card, check your balance, and recharge Hafilat card instantly using a credit or debit card. The process is intuitive, and you can top up any amount starting from as little as AED 20.

For those who prefer a more traditional approach, recharging your Hafilat card at authorized ticket vending machines is another reliable option. These machines are widely available at major bus stations and transport hubs. You simply insert your card, select the recharge amount, and pay using cash or card. This method is especially useful if you’re already at a station and want to add balance before boarding a bus.

In addition, many convenience stores across Abu Dhabi, including supermarkets and small kiosks, offer Hafilat card recharge services. While it may not be as instantaneous as using the app or a vending machine, it’s a practical solution if you’re nearby and don’t have access to digital payment methods.

Step-by-Step Guide to Recharge Hafilat Card via the App

If you’re someone who prefers digital convenience, using the Hafilat app is the fastest way to recharge Hafilat card. Here’s a step-by-step breakdown based on my experience:

  1. Download the official Hafilat app from Google Play Store or Apple App Store.
  2. Register with your details and link your Hafilat card to your account.
  3. Open the “Recharge” section and choose the amount you wish to load onto your card.
  4. Complete the payment using your preferred method, such as a debit or credit card.
  5. Wait a few moments for the balance to update. You can now use your card immediately.

Using the app not only saves time but also allows you to keep track of your travel history and balance conveniently. Personally, I find it reassuring to know that I can top up Hafilat card even while on the move, without needing to search for a physical machine.

How to Recharge Hafilat Card at Stations

For those who enjoy hands-on options, topping up at bus stations is straightforward. Most major bus stations in Abu Dhabi have dedicated Hafilat kiosks and vending machines. The process is simple: insert your card, choose the top-up amount, make the payment, and your card is ready to use.

A tip from experience: always keep small cash on hand if you’re using vending machines. Sometimes, card payments may encounter technical glitches, but cash is universally accepted. Common Issues and How to Avoid Them

While recharging Hafilat card is generally smooth, a few common issues can arise. One of the most frequent problems is the card not updating immediately after a recharge, particularly when using vending machines. If this happens, make sure to wait a few minutes and try tapping the card on the reader again. The system usually syncs automatically, and your balance will reflect the new amount.

Another issue is entering the wrong card number during online recharge. Always double-check that you’ve linked the correct Hafilat card in the app to avoid sending money to the wrong account. It’s a simple mistake that can be easily avoided by verifying your card details before confirming the transaction.

Lastly, keep in mind that topping up your Hafilat card at convenience stores may take slightly longer to process. While it’s rare, some locations may have connectivity issues, so it’s always a good idea to check your balance after making a payment.
